NumisMedia Weekly Market Report
February 7, 2011
Morgan & Peace Dollars Climbing
The Long Beach Coin Expo was a little quieter than usual because of the weather conditions around the country that restricted travel for many dealers. But for those in attendance it was business as usual as wholesale dealers made the most of trading with other dealers and the public took advantage of lower metal prices to purchase modern bullion coins and sets. Most dealers and collectors appeared to be satisfied with trades, the market, and the show in general.
With Gold under the $1,350 mark, the one-ounce Proof Gold Eagles are trading at $1,535 between dealers. At one time these were well over $2,000, so buyers are feeling like they are getting a bargain at current levels. Most buyers still think that Gold is destined to move to a much higher price. The 2009 UHR continues to be in strong demand as prices have held steady over the last few months. The Prooflike coins have been very popular.
In this week's HD Wholesale Market Dealer Price Guide most series are active at present levels with the exception of generic Gold coins. Many of the common dates have drifted lower in the circulated grades up to MS63. Again, many buyers think this is an opportunity to add to their investment holdings. Morgan and Peace Dollars are very strong at higher Market prices. Lots of buyers make these coins difficult to locate in quantity. When most deals of MS63 to MS65 are offered on the Teletypes, they sell very quickly. Morgan Dollars in MS63 are up to $43 while the MS64 is higher at $67. MS65's have advanced to $142 and there are still many buyers at this level.

NumisMedia Weekly Dealer Price Guides
Weekly and Online Wholesale Prices
NumisMedia presents Wholesale Dealer Prices representing dealer trading levels for properly graded sight-seen coins.
Subscribers to the Dealer Price Guides will receive our Weekly Wholesale Market Dealer Price Guides and access to all of our Online and Mobile Price Guides: Market, FMV, PCGS, NGC, CAC, & Plus +.
Our Weekly NumisMedia Wholesale Market Dealer Price Guide package of 52 issues a year includes:
The Classic HD has grades from Fine through MS68 in every U.S. series in the higher denominations: Halves, Dollars, Gold, and Commemoratives.
The Classic LD has grades from Fine through MS68 in every U.S. series in the lower denominations: Half Cents through Quarters.
The Moderns Edition has grades from AU50 through MS70 in every Modern series.
